What Does the Brain Emoji 🧠 Mean?
The brain emoji 🧠 represents a human brain and is commonly used to talk about thinking, intelligence, knowledge, learning, ideas, and mental activity.
Unicode lists its official name as Brain, with the code point U+1F9E0. Unicode’s emoji annotations also associate the character with concepts such as the brain and intelligence.
In everyday texting, however, people can use 🧠 in many different ways.
It may mean:
- “Think about this.”
- “Use your brain.”
- “That is smart.”
- “I have an idea.”
- “I’m studying.”
- “This is complicated.”
- “I’m trying to figure it out.”
- “That requires a lot of thinking.”
- “That’s a clever idea.”
- “My brain is overloaded.”
The emoji does not automatically indicate one specific emotion. It is more about mental activity or intelligence than feelings.

🧠 Meaning for “Big Brain”
One playful use of 🧠 is the phrase “big brain.”
People may use it to jokingly describe something clever, strategic, or unexpectedly intelligent.
For example:
“I brought an umbrella because the weather app said it might rain. Big brain 🧠”
The statement is intentionally exaggerated. The person is presenting an ordinary decision as a brilliant one.
You may also see:
“Big brain move 🧠”
This usually means:
“That was a smart move.”
Depending on the context, it can be sincere or sarcastic.
For example:
“You saved the file before restarting. Big brain move 🧠”
could be genuine praise.
But:
“You locked your keys inside the car. Big brain move 🧠”
is clearly sarcastic because the surrounding situation contradicts the compliment.

Related Emojis and Their Meanings
Several emojis can be confused with 🧠 because they also relate to thinking, intelligence, ideas, learning, or mental reactions.
| Emoji | Official Name | Common Meaning | Tone | Where or When It Is Used |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 🧠 | Brain | Thinking, intelligence, knowledge, mental effort | Intelligent, serious, playful | Studying, problem-solving, clever comments, ideas |
| 🤔 | Thinking Face | Thinking, uncertainty, questioning, consideration | Thoughtful, doubtful, curious | Questions, decisions, uncertainty, reflection |
| 💡 | Light Bulb | Idea, realization, inspiration | Clever, positive, creative | New ideas, solutions, discoveries, brainstorming |
| 🤓 | Nerd Face | Intelligence, studying, enthusiasm for knowledge | Playful, academic, sometimes self-deprecating | School, books, science, hobbies, clever jokes |
| 🧐 | Face with Monocle | Careful examination, curiosity, scrutiny | Curious, serious, playful | Inspecting details, questioning claims, joking analysis |
| 🤯 | Exploding Head | Shock, amazement, overwhelming information | Dramatic, amazed | Surprising facts, complicated ideas, shocking discoveries |
| 💭 | Thought Balloon | Thought, idea, reflection, imagining | Reflective, gentle | Thoughts, memories, imagination, internal dialogue |
| 📚 | Books | Reading, studying, education, knowledge | Academic, educational | Schoolwork, reading, research, learning |
| 🧩 | Puzzle Piece | Problem-solving, complexity, fitting pieces together | Playful, thoughtful | Puzzles, solutions, complicated situations |
The most important distinction is between 🧠, 🤔, and 💡.
🧠 represents the brain, intelligence, or mental activity.
🤔 focuses on a person who is thinking, questioning, or uncertain.
💡 usually represents an idea, inspiration, or moment of realization.
For studying, 📚 may be more direct because it represents books. For a dramatic reaction to an unexpected idea, 🤯 can be much stronger than 🧠.

Does 🧠 Have a Hidden Meaning on Social Media?
The standard meaning of 🧠 remains connected to the brain, thinking, intelligence, and mental activity.
However, some online communities can give ordinary emojis additional slang meanings. Emojipedia notes that the brain emoji can have an alternative NSFW interpretation on some platforms, including TikTok.
That interpretation is highly context-dependent and should not be assumed whenever you see 🧠.
In ordinary educational, conversational, or general social-media use, the straightforward meanings—thinking, intelligence, knowledge, ideas, or mental effort—are usually the relevant ones.
Official Brain Emoji Details
The official Unicode name is Brain.
Emoji: 🧠
Unicode code point: U+1F9E0
Unicode introduction: Unicode 10.0
Emoji version: Emoji 5.0
Unicode’s emoji charts identify 🧠 as U+1F9E0 Brain, while Emojipedia records its approval in Unicode 10.0 and addition to Emoji 5.0 in 2017.
The emoji is generally displayed as a pink human brain, although its exact artwork can differ between platforms and operating systems. These visual differences do not normally change its basic meaning.
